Recognizing Cashmere: a Closer Look at Its Origins



Revered for its elegant soft qualities and warmth, cashmere represents the epitome of polished convenience on the planet of textiles. It stems from the coarse, cosy undercoat of the Kashmir goat, mostly located in severe environments of Mongolia, China, and India. Strikingly, each goat yields mere 150 grams of the valuable fiber each year, after an arduous procedure of arranging and combing. This clarifies the high worth cashmere commands out there. Its scarcity, paired with the extensive labor needed for its manufacturing, adds to its exclusivity. The all-natural insulation homes of cashmere also make it a favorite for winter fashion. In spite of its delicate appearance, cashmere is extremely resilient, providing the ideal mix of luxury and durability.


The Lasting Manufacturing Process of Cashmere



While the luxury and allure of cashmere are obvious, the techniques of its manufacturing additionally hold considerable relevance. The lasting manufacturing of cashmere entails a careful and green process. The fibers are accumulated each derive from goats in Mongolia and China without causing injury to the pets. Each goat generates just a few ounces of the valuable fiber, guaranteeing its rarity and value. The fibers are then sorted by hand, cleaned, and spun right into thread, a procedure that calls for marginal equipment and adds to neighborhood economic situations. This careful, ethical process reduces environmental impact and promotes the long life of the cashmere-producing goat populaces.
